Description
The Philadelphia VA Medical Center, Philadelphia, PA intends to enter into a sole source contract with Verge Solutions, LLC, P.O. Box 394, Mount Pleasant, SC 29465 to obtain a VSurvey software license. Due to the unique capabilities of the VSurvey software, it has been identified as the only software product capable of fulfilling the Government's needs. Required software features include the fact that VSurvey has: a build-in cross walk between the Joint Commission and the CMS regulations; the ability to import and manage an unlimited number of regulatory standards and manage the process of annual or semi-annual updates as the regulations change; combines document management features with regulatory compliance, allowing the user to attach policies, meeting minutes, etc. at the EP or CoP levels as evidence to support scoring, etc. This announcement constitutes the only notice issued; a separate written solicitation will NOT be issued. This procurement is being conducted in accordance with FAR 6.302-1, only one responsible source and no other supplies and services will satisfy agency requirements. A justification for other than full and open competition has been prepared in support of this acquisition. This notice is not a request for competitive proposals. A determination by the Government not to compete this proposed requirement based on responses to this notice is solely within the discretion of the Government. Vendors offering software including all of the features listed above and comparable to the VSurvey are invited to respond to this notice by supplying descriptive information about their software to the designated Contracting Officer not later than 4:00 pm (EDT) on Friday, April 3, 2009. Information received will be considered solely for the purpose of determining whether to conduct a competitive procurement. Response must be in writing to the Contracting Officer.
